1// Code generated by software.amazon.smithy.rust.codegen.smithy-rs. DO NOT EDIT.
2#![allow(clippy::empty_line_after_doc_comments)]
3/// Configuration for a aws_sdk_securityhub service client.
4///
5/// Service configuration allows for customization of endpoints, region, credentials providers,
6/// and retry configuration. Generally, it is constructed automatically for you from a shared
7/// configuration loaded by the `aws-config` crate. For example:
8///
9/// ```ignore
10/// // Load a shared config from the environment
11/// let shared_config = aws_config::from_env().load().await;
12/// // The client constructor automatically converts the shared config into the service config
13/// let client = Client::new(&shared_config);
14/// ```
15///
16/// The service config can also be constructed manually using its builder.
17///

725        self
726    }
727    /// Set the partition for retry-related state. When clients share a retry partition, they will
728    /// also share components such as token buckets and client rate limiters.
729    /// See the [`RetryPartition`](::aws_smithy_runtime::client::retries::RetryPartition) documentation for more details.
730    ///
731    /// # Default Behavior
732    ///
733    /// When no retry partition is explicitly set, the SDK automatically creates a default retry partition named `securityhub`
734    /// (or `securityhub-<region>` if a region is configured).
735    /// All SecurityHub clients without an explicit retry partition will share this default partition.
736    ///
737    /// # Notes
738    ///
739    /// - This is an advanced setting — most users won't need to modify it.
740    /// - A configured client rate limiter has no effect unless [`RetryConfig::adaptive`](::aws_smithy_types::retry::RetryConfig::adaptive) is used.
741    ///
742    /// # Examples
743    ///
744    /// Creating a custom retry partition with a token bucket:
745    /// ```no_run
746    /// use aws_sdk_securityhub::config::Config;
747    /// use aws_sdk_securityhub::config::retry::{RetryPartition, TokenBucket};
748    ///
749    /// let token_bucket = TokenBucket::new(10);
750    /// let config = Config::builder()
751    ///     .retry_partition(RetryPartition::custom("custom")
752    ///         .token_bucket(token_bucket)
753    ///         .build()
754    ///     )
755    ///     .build();
756    /// ```
757    ///
758    /// Configuring a client rate limiter with adaptive retry mode:
759    /// ```no_run
760    /// use aws_sdk_securityhub::config::Config;
761    /// use aws_sdk_securityhub::config::retry::{ClientRateLimiter, RetryConfig, RetryPartition};
762    ///
763    /// let client_rate_limiter = ClientRateLimiter::new(10.0);
764    /// let config = Config::builder()
765    ///     .retry_partition(RetryPartition::custom("custom")
766    ///         .client_rate_limiter(client_rate_limiter)
767    ///         .build()
768    ///     )
769    ///     .retry_config(RetryConfig::adaptive())
770    ///     .build();
771    /// ```
772    pub fn retry_partition(mut self, retry_partition: ::aws_smithy_runtime::client::retries::RetryPartition) -> Self {
773        self.set_retry_partition(Some(retry_partition));

782        self
783    }
784    /// Set the identity cache for auth.
785    ///
786    /// The identity cache defaults to a lazy caching implementation that will resolve
787    /// an identity when it is requested, and place it in the cache thereafter. Subsequent
788    /// requests will take the value from the cache while it is still valid. Once it expires,
789    /// the next request will result in refreshing the identity.
790    ///
791    /// This configuration allows you to disable or change the default caching mechanism.
792    /// To use a custom caching mechanism, implement the [`ResolveCachedIdentity`](crate::config::ResolveCachedIdentity)
793    /// trait and pass that implementation into this function.
794    ///
795    /// # Examples
796    ///
797    /// Disabling identity caching:
798    /// ```no_run
799    /// use aws_sdk_securityhub::config::IdentityCache;
800    ///
801    /// let config = aws_sdk_securityhub::Config::builder()
802    ///     .identity_cache(IdentityCache::no_cache())
803    ///     // ...
804    ///     .build();
805    /// let client = aws_sdk_securityhub::Client::from_conf(config);
806    /// ```
807    ///
808    /// Customizing lazy caching:
809    /// ```no_run
810    /// use aws_sdk_securityhub::config::IdentityCache;
811    /// use std::time::Duration;
812    ///
813    /// let config = aws_sdk_securityhub::Config::builder()
814    ///     .identity_cache(
815    ///         IdentityCache::lazy()
816    ///             // change the load timeout to 10 seconds
817    ///             .load_timeout(Duration::from_secs(10))
818    ///             .build()
819    ///     )
820    ///     // ...
821    ///     .build();
822    /// let client = aws_sdk_securityhub::Client::from_conf(config);
823    /// ```
824    ///
825    pub fn identity_cache(mut self, identity_cache: impl crate::config::ResolveCachedIdentity + 'static) -> Self {
826        self.set_identity_cache(identity_cache);
